L'Escarboucle, L'ÉCOLE, School of Jewelry Arts and the Art of Books
December 19, 2024
Since its creation in 2012 with the support of Van Cleef & Arpels, L’ÉCOLE, School of Jewelry Arts has sought to share jewelry culture with the general public, in France and around the globe. Every year, it initiates numerous publications, among them exhibition catalogues, works for the general public and symposium proceedings. The diversity of these works bears witness to L’ÉCOLE’s founding tenets of remaining open to all and of providing instruction around three main pillars: the history of jewelry, jewelry savoir-faire and the world of gemstones. This year, L’ÉCOLE, School of Jewelry Arts has further expanded its reach with the opening of the Hôtel de Mercy-Argenteau, its newest address in Paris, which includes two spaces entirely devoted to books: a specialized library and the Escarboucle bookshop.
The library at L’ÉCOLE, School of Jewelry Arts
In an exceptional eighteenth-century mansion, the library offers six thousand works available for perusal on-site, free of charge. From the stage jewels of the Comédie Française to the fabulous destiny of Tavernier’s diamonds, from Jean Vendome to Daniel Brush, from men’s rings to designing jewels and from birds in paradise to precious stones, the breadth of themes is matched only by a wide variety of formats. Visits to the library are available by appointment to students and researchers as well as novices and visitors driven by simple curiosity.
L’Escarboucle, the bookshop of L’ÉCOLE, School of Jewelry Arts
First bookshop entirely dedicated to the jewelry arts, l'Escarboucle derives from the Latin word "carbunculus" meaning "small embers" used formerly to designate precious stones of a fiery red hue. With a surface area of nearly one hundred square meters, the bookshop counts nearly three thousand works, available for purchase, on jewelry, designers, savoir-faire and gemology. Conceived by the designer, interior architect and scenographer Constance Guisset, the new address presents rare books and geodes.
